Hopcelot by Lawson’s Finest Liquids is an American IPA and is being evaluated as an American IPA (category 21A from the 2021 BJCP Beer Style Guidelines). American IPAs are hop-forward beers typically expressing American or new world hop characters that are most typically citrusy, piney or resiny in character. Hopcelot was brewed with eight different hop varieties from around the world.

Hopcelot pours straw in color, has a very slight haze and holds aloft a big white head. The aroma is of strong resiny and piney hops with just a hint of malt. The flavor is once again prominent hops showcasing flavors of citrus, pine and resins; just a hint of malt peeks out from behind the hops. The beer finishes moderately bitter with citrusy, piney and resiny hops lingering for ages into the aftertaste.

This is a fantastic American IPA. The hop profile has tremendous balance and depth that is maintained from the first sniff to the final drop. This is everything an American IPA is meant to be – prominent hop aromas and flavors and an ultra-clean level of bitterness. And have I mentioned the balance and depth of the hop character?! What an awesome job of hop selection and blending by the brewer! WOW! Truly a World Class brew.
